Shown below are Target's Haulathon event drops for week 1, including:

NECA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les (Mirage Comics) - Gangster Turtles 4-Pack
NECA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les (Cartoon) - Creepy Eddie & Shibano-Sama 2-Pack
NECA Beetlejuice Beetlejuice Ultimate Red Wedding Tuxedo Beetlejuice
Kidrobot Hello Kitty Mermaid 13" plush


Items available for purchase at 8am CT. Limit 2 per item per order.
Celebrate Haulathon’s 5th anniversary with drops every Friday, 4/11 to 5/16.
